什么是普通区块链?
普通区块链是一种去中心化的分布式分类账本技术。它是由一系列区块组成的链表结构,每个区块包含了一些交易记录,并通过密码学哈希值链接在一起。每个区块都包含了前一个区块的哈希值,形成了区块链。普通区块链的特点是数据的透明性、不可篡改性和去中心化。
区块链的运作原理是什么?
普通区块链的运作原理可以分为以下几个步骤:
- 交易验证:在区块链网络中,参与者发起交易,并广播给网络中的其他节点。每个节点都会验证交易的合法性,包括验证交易的有效性和发送者的身份。
- 区块生成:经过验证的交易被打包成一个区块。每个区块都包含了一段时间内的交易记录。区块通过计算其数据的哈希值生成,同时还包含了前一个区块的哈希值。
- 区块链共识:当一个区块生成后,它需要被加入到区块链中。这就需要网络中的节点达成共识。常见的共识算法有工作量证明(Proof of Work)、权益证明(Proof of Stake)等。
- 区块链扩展:区块链是不断扩展的,每个新的区块都会被加入到链的末尾。这样就保证了数据的完整性和可靠性。
- 区块链验证:每个节点都拥有完整的区块链副本,可以对任何交易进行验证和查询。
普通区块链有哪些优势?
普通区块链具有以下几个优势:
- 去中心化:普通区块链没有中心化的控制机构,所有参与者平等参与共识,增加了系统的安全性和可信度。
- 透明性:普通区块链的所有交易记录对所有参与者可见,任何人都可以查看和验证交易的有效性。
- 安全性:通过使用密码学哈希和共识机制,普通区块链确保交易的不可篡改性和数据的完整性。
- 高效性:普通区块链可以实现快速、安全的交易处理和结算,减少了中间环节的需求。
普通区块链应用场景有哪些?
普通区块链已经被广泛应用于多个领域,包括:
- 金融行业:普通区块链可以用于支付、结算、跨境汇款等领域,提高交易的速度和安全性。
- 物联网:普通区块链可以用于设备之间的信任建立和数据交换,确保物联网设备的安全性。
- 供应链管理:普通区块链可以追踪产品的整个供应链过程,确保数据的真实性和可信度。
- 医疗行业:普通区块链可以用于电子病历的管理和共享,提高医疗信息的安全性和可访问性。
普通区块链的发展前景如何?
普通区块链作为一种新兴的技术,具有广阔的发展前景。随着对区块链技术认识的不断深入和应用场景的拓展,普通区块链有望在多个领域产生革命性的影响。同时,普通区块链面临着一些挑战,如性能扩展、隐私保护等问题,但随着技术的进步,这些问题也有望得到解决。
如何学习和应用普通区块链技术?
学习普通区块链技术可以通过以下几个步骤:
- 了解基本概念:首先需要了解区块链的基本概念和运作原理,包括去中心化、哈希算法、共识机制等。
- 学习编程知识:掌握一门编程语言,如Solidity、C 等,这样可以参与到智能合约的开发中。
- 实践项目:参与区块链项目的开发和实践,可以通过开发智能合约、搭建私有链等方式来加深对区块链技术的理解。
- 持续学习:区块链技术发展迅速,要持续学习最新的研究成果和应用案例,保持对区块链技术的敏感度。
总结起来,普通区块链是一种去中心化的分布式分类账本技术,通过密码学哈希值链接交易记录,并具有透明性、不可篡改性和去中心化的特点。普通区块链的运作原理包括交易验证、区块生成、区块链共识和扩展等。它具有去中心化、透明性、安全性和高效性等优势,并广泛应用于金融、物联网、供应链管理和医疗行业等领域。普通区块链技术具有广阔的发展前景,在学习和应用方面需要掌握基本概念、编程知识,并实践项目,持续学习最新的研究成果。